Cost of Wood Siding Installation in Middletown
Wood siding is a popular choice for homeowners in Middletown, DE, due to its natural beauty and durability. However, the cost of wood siding installation can vary significantly based on several factors. Understanding these variables can help you budget more effectively for your home improvement project.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Wood: Different wood species come at varying price points, with cedar and redwood generally being more expensive than pine.
- Size of the House: Larger homes require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ary depending on the contractor's experience and the complexity of the job.
- Condition of Existing Siding: If old siding needs to be removed, this will add to the total cost.
- Customization: Special treatments, finishes, or custom cuts can increase the price.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
| Task Description | Average Cost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Wood Siding Installation | $6,000 - $12,000 |
| Removal of Old Siding | $1,000 - $2,500 |
| Custom Finishes and Treatments | $500 - $1,500 |
| Permits and Inspections | $200 - $500 |
| Labor Costs (per square foot) | $3 - $7 |
